Vaillant had discovered seven major factors that predict healthy aging, both mentally and physically.

One example was the use of mature adaptations. Education, a stable marriage, not smoking, not drinking excessively, some exercise, and a healthy weight were the others. Half of the 106 Harvard men who just had five or six of these variables in their favor at 50 ended up as "happy-well" and only 7.5 percent as "sad-sick."

Meanwhile, none of the men who had 3 or lesser of the aspects of health at the age of 50 were "happy-well" at the age of 80.

Ethnocentrism, in social science and anthropology, refers to the application of one's own culture or ethnicity as a frame of reference to judge other cultures, behaviors, practices, beliefs, and people, rather than using the standards of the specific culture involved. It generally entails considering culture and practices of one's own group superior to others" or judging other groups as inferior to one's own. Ethnocentrism is maintained and perpetuated by stereotypes, which refers to over generalized beliefs about a particular group or class of people which may include beliefs about their appearance, behavior, or other characteristics.

According to the social penetration theory, communication progresses from relatively shallow, nonintimate levels to deeper, more personal ones as relationships develop. Theory stating that interpersonal relationships evolve in gradual and predictable ways, with self-disclosure being the primary way for superficial relationships to progress to more intimate relationships. Individuals may become more vulnerable as a result of self-disclosure.

Another important assumption is that people in new relationships will always talk about a wide range of topics and care about how others perceive them. Irwin Altman and Dalmas Taylor developed the social penetration theory and model. They investigated how relationships develop and become more intimate, as well as how social relationships can grow more distant. They establish a link between social relationship strength and the regularity and complexity of interpersonal communication.

What is session hijacking and its types?

Session hijacking is a technique used by hackers to gain access to a victim's computer or online accounts. Session hijacking attacks allow hackers to control a user's browsing session to gain access to personal information and passwords.

There are two types of session hijacking, depending on how you do it. If the attacker directly engages the target, it is called active hijacking, and if the attacker only passively monitors the traffic, it is called passive  hijacking.
